Trump’s approval PLUNGES: How the Iran war is ‘EATING his presidency’

Published

on

By



An analysis by The New York Times shows President Trump’s most recent polling numbers have hit new lows heading into the midterms. The piece highlights several new polls in recent days that find barely a third of Americans approve of the job Trump is doing as the war in Iran continues and gas prices remain high. The president’s poll numbers are currently at or near the lowest they have ever been in some non-partisan surveys. The latest polling indicates Trump is now all but the most unpopular second term president at this state of their tenure in the history of polling going back to the 1940’s, with the exception of Richard Nixon was just days away from resigning over the Watergate scandal at this time during his second term. The Morning Joe panel discusses the president’s consistently falling poll numbers and why Rich Lowry with the National Review writes that “The Iran War is Eating Trump’s Presidency.”
